    Factors Influencing Vitz Car Prices in Ethiopia

    Alright, so you're probably wondering: "What exactly determines the price of a Vitz in Ethiopia?" Well, it's not as simple as just looking up a standard price tag. Several factors come into play, and understanding these will give you a much clearer picture. Let's break it down:

    • Year of Manufacture: Like any car, the age of the Vitz significantly impacts its price. A newer model, like a 2020 or 2021, will naturally cost more than an older one, say a 2015 or 2016. This is because newer models often come with updated features, better fuel efficiency, and generally less wear and tear. Think of it like buying a new phone versus a used one – the newer the model, the more you'll likely pay. In Ethiopia, where import duties and taxes can be significant, even a slight difference in the year of manufacture can lead to a noticeable price jump. So, keep this in mind as you browse through different options. Consider your budget and how important having the latest model is to you. Sometimes, a slightly older Vitz in excellent condition can be a much smarter buy than a newer one that's been poorly maintained.

    • Condition of the Car: This is a biggie! A Vitz in pristine condition, with low mileage and a spotless service record, will command a higher price than one that's been through the wringer. Look for signs of wear and tear, such as scratches, dents, or rust. Check the interior for any damage or stains. More importantly, get the car inspected by a trusted mechanic before you commit to buying it. They can identify any potential problems that you might not be able to spot yourself. Remember, a cheap car that needs a lot of repairs can end up costing you more in the long run. Don't be afraid to negotiate the price based on the car's condition. If it needs some work, use that as leverage to get a better deal.

    • Mileage: The number of kilometers (or miles) a car has clocked is a good indicator of how much it's been used. Lower mileage generally means less wear and tear on the engine and other components. However, it's not the only thing that matters. A car with high mileage but that has been meticulously maintained might be a better buy than one with low mileage that has been neglected. Always ask for the service history and check for any signs of tampering with the odometer. In Ethiopia, where roads can be tough on vehicles, mileage is an especially important factor to consider. Be realistic about your needs. If you only plan to use the car for short commutes around town, high mileage might not be a deal-breaker. But if you're planning on long road trips, you'll definitely want to prioritize a Vitz with lower mileage.

    • Transmission Type (Automatic vs. Manual): This is a matter of personal preference, but it can also affect the price. Automatic transmissions are generally more expensive than manual transmissions, both to buy and to maintain. In Ethiopia, where traffic congestion can be a major issue, automatic transmissions are becoming increasingly popular. They're simply easier to drive in stop-and-go traffic. However, manual transmissions offer better fuel efficiency and can be more engaging to drive. If you're comfortable with a manual transmission and want to save some money, that might be the way to go. But if you value convenience and ease of driving, an automatic transmission is probably worth the extra cost. Think about your daily driving habits and choose the transmission type that best suits your needs.

    • Import Duties and Taxes: This is a major factor that significantly impacts car prices in Ethiopia. The Ethiopian government levies various import duties and taxes on vehicles, which can add a substantial amount to the final price. These duties and taxes vary depending on the age and engine size of the car. Newer cars and cars with larger engines are typically subject to higher taxes. It's important to be aware of these costs when budgeting for your Vitz. You can usually find information about import duties and taxes on the Ethiopian Revenue and Customs Authority (ERCA) website. Also, keep in mind that these regulations can change from time to time, so it's always a good idea to check the latest updates before making a purchase. Some importers may include these costs in the quoted price, while others may not. Be sure to clarify this with the seller to avoid any surprises.

    Where to Find Vitz Cars for Sale in Ethiopia

    Okay, now that you know what to look for, let's talk about where to actually find Vitz cars for sale in Ethiopia. You've got a few options:

    • Online Marketplaces: Online platforms are a great place to start your search. Websites like Yes.et and Merkato.com often have listings for used cars, including Vitz models. The advantage here is convenience – you can browse through a wide selection of cars from the comfort of your home. However, be cautious when buying online. Always verify the seller's credentials and inspect the car in person before making any payment. Don't rely solely on the pictures and descriptions provided online. Ask for additional photos or videos if needed. And if possible, bring a mechanic with you to inspect the car thoroughly. Remember, it's always better to be safe than sorry. Online marketplaces can be a good starting point, but they shouldn't be the only place you look.

    • Car Dealerships: Visiting car dealerships can provide a more traditional buying experience. You can find both new and used Vitz cars at dealerships, and you'll have the opportunity to speak with sales representatives who can answer your questions. Dealerships often offer financing options and warranties, which can provide peace of mind. However, prices at dealerships tend to be higher than those offered by private sellers. This is because dealerships have overhead costs to cover, such as rent, salaries, and advertising. Before visiting a dealership, do some research online to get an idea of the average price for the Vitz model you're interested in. This will give you a better negotiating position. Also, don't be afraid to shop around and compare prices at different dealerships. You might be surprised at how much the prices can vary. And remember, always read the fine print before signing any documents.

    • Private Sellers: Buying directly from a private seller can sometimes offer the best deals. You might be able to negotiate a lower price than you would at a dealership. However, buying from a private seller also comes with more risk. You'll need to do your own due diligence to ensure that the car is in good condition and that the seller is legitimate. Ask for the car's registration documents and service history. Check for any outstanding liens or encumbrances. And most importantly, have the car inspected by a trusted mechanic before making any payment. If possible, meet the seller in a public place and bring a friend or family member with you. Trust your gut instinct – if something feels off, don't hesitate to walk away. Buying from a private seller can be a great way to save money, but it requires more effort and caution.

    Tips for Getting the Best Deal on a Vitz in Ethiopia

    Alright, you're armed with knowledge! Now, let's talk about how to snag the best possible deal on your Vitz.

    • Do Your Research: Knowledge is power! Before you even start looking at cars, research the average price for the Vitz model you're interested in. Check online marketplaces, car dealerships, and classified ads to get a sense of the market. This will give you a baseline for negotiation. Also, research the specific features and specifications of the Vitz model you're considering. This will help you assess its value and identify any potential issues. The more you know, the better equipped you'll be to negotiate a fair price.

    • Negotiate, Negotiate, Negotiate: Don't be afraid to haggle! Most sellers expect you to negotiate the price, so don't accept the first offer you receive. Start by making a lower offer than what you're willing to pay and be prepared to walk away if the seller doesn't budge. Use any flaws or issues with the car as leverage to negotiate a lower price. For example, if the car needs new tires or has some minor scratches, point those out to the seller and ask for a discount. Be polite but firm in your negotiations. And remember, the goal is to reach a price that's fair to both you and the seller.

    • Get a Pre-Purchase Inspection: This is crucial! Spending a little money on a pre-purchase inspection can save you a lot of money in the long run. A qualified mechanic can identify any potential problems with the car that you might not be able to spot yourself. They can check the engine, transmission, brakes, suspension, and other critical components. If the mechanic finds any issues, you can use that information to negotiate a lower price or even walk away from the deal. The cost of a pre-purchase inspection is usually a small fraction of the overall cost of the car, and it's well worth the investment.

    • Consider the Total Cost of Ownership: Don't just focus on the purchase price. Think about the ongoing costs of owning a car, such as fuel, insurance, maintenance, and repairs. Vitz cars are generally known for their fuel efficiency, but it's still important to factor in the cost of fuel when budgeting for your car. Insurance costs can vary depending on the age and value of the car, as well as your driving history. Maintenance costs will depend on how well the car has been maintained and how often you drive it. And repairs can be unpredictable, but it's always a good idea to have some money set aside for unexpected expenses. By considering the total cost of ownership, you can get a more accurate picture of how much the car will actually cost you.
